What’s really difficult for an aspiring manga comic or webcomic artist? You do not know where to start from.

This has happened to me before, and on many occasions up to know, the lack of resources continues to try to haunt me relentlessly.

There are too few success stories to learn from, and noone’s giving good advice into how to start their own manga comic or webcomic saga.

Even right now, I am still learning the ropes as I go along, and I pretty guess there are many out there who are lacking in resources.

I wished I had 80 hours for a day.

Like many aspiring manga comic or webcomic artists, time is a factor that we all have to tackle.

As we still have our daily responsibilies and affairs to handle, such as studying or working our day job, we become distracted or even lose interest in practicising or drawing comics.
